Days Eleven & Twelve *Polka Dots & Stripes*

 Day 11- I really wanted to use OPI- Russian Navy- Matte in one of these posts so I decided today would be a perfect day to use it, I painted 2 coats of Russian Navy and then painted the little dots with nail art polishes (the ones with the needle point tip), I used Claire's Cosmetics in Neon Pink and Nail Star in White. I think the effect was really pretty and I finished the manicure off with Sally Hansens Mega Shine (as per usual). I think this could be my favourite and it was really easy to do.

Day 12- I know I said in my Green day that I don't like green nail polish but I think this one is different, it is so bright and happy and I had completely forgotten about until I found it at the back of one of nail polish drawers, the colours I used are all by BYS, Matte Green and Black and White nail art polishes! I think these nails are really cute and I got lots of comments on these at work. I was going to paint them with a matte top coat but I am glad I didn't, I think the Mega Shine makes them pop.


Days Eight, Nine & Ten *Metallic, Rainbow & Gradient*

 Day 8- I just picked up this metallic polish, it is Kleancolor- Midnight Queen, it is a really pretty green/blue colour that I fell in love with when I saw it. I don't think this needs much explantion.

Day 9- Rainbow nails seemed like it would be really fun and it was. I painted my nails white (Sally Hansen-Xtreme wear- White Out) and then painted rainbow lines using BYS nail art polishes in Pink, Yellow, Red, Blue, Orange, Neon Green and Purple. These were fun to do and didn't take too long. After I did mine my Nana wanted hers done the same so I spent some time doing hers like it too which was fun.

Day 10- I didn't have much time to do gradient nails as I was on holiday at my parents place so by the time I got back to Wellington it was late and I was tired and had to be up for work at 5am!!! The colours I used for the gradient nails are Rimmel- I love Lasting Finish in Hot Shot and BYS Matte Deep Berry and Black Cherry, I tried to get a good gradient effect but the Deep Berry colour was too similar to Hot Shots so there isn't much diffence, it still worked just not as well as I had hoped.
